10. Programmable
The four buttons are intended to be user programmable via software
in applicable operating systems.
11. Power
M
• ay be configured to perform different functions, depending on
the software operating system.
D
• epending on the OS, a brief, firm push will trigger software-enabled
entry into Shutdown or Standby modes. Push in similar manner to
Restart or to exit Standby mode.
P
• ush and hold for over 4 seconds to forcefully shut down the device.
This method of powering off should only be used when proper
shutdown through software is not possible.
Rear Mounting
The WebDT DS1500/ 1700 is designed to be secured to VESA-compliant mounting arms or
stands. This is accomplished by detaching the standard metal base from the rear of the
display unit. The VESA-compliant mounting holes at the rear of the device will mate with
VESA mounts or arms to meet the requirements of the deployment.
